November, late autumn... a difficult time for many. Little sun. Bare trees. Short daylight hours... At this time, people often get sick, chronic diseases emerge... And if you also have problems with energy, if you are in a situation of emotional burnout... Moreover, it’s time to restore your strength and energy! So , let's figure out what often takes away our vitality? 1. Poorly organized holiday. Lifestyle. How do you relax and sleep? Is it enough? How is your day structured?2. The habit of creating unfinished tasks. When something was left unsaid, unfinished, misunderstood. It takes energy, the brain constantly keeps it in mind. And you are under emotional stress.3. Failure to maintain a balance of take and give. For example, you only invest in something, but do not get any return from it. Moreover, the return is not necessarily money. And emotions, feedback, results. Your personal meaning and pleasure from the process. Understanding why you are doing this.4. Perfectionism. You spend a lot of effort to do something perfectly.5. A sharp increase in loads and overload. Unhealthy ambitions. The desire to be on time everywhere. Get everything at once.6. Obsessive thoughts, spinning and replaying various negative thoughts and all sorts of “what if...”7. Communicating with people who manipulate and violate your boundaries. They're putting pressure. With whom it’s just difficult for you personally. Friends, now let’s talk about ways to restore energy and resources. I have prepared 10 points for you: Write your resource list. What usually fills you up? What inspires you? What helps you get your energy back? Movies, music, silence, walks, massage, sports, communication with certain people. Sleep and food. Get enough sleep and eat normally. Minimize interactions with people who make you feel bad. Consume less unnecessary information. Don’t demand constant productivity and efficiency from yourself. Instead, complete tasks that don't require a lot of energy. Don't plan major changes in your life if your energy is at zero. Dream on. Imagine your ideal day. In every detail and detail. You can turn on some nice music. Do something like meditation for yourself. Do something you've dreamed of for a long time, but put off. Go to a beautiful place, buy yourself a dress. Give yourself a “day of spontaneity.” Allow yourself to wake up without an alarm clock. Don't plan anything. Just listen to yourself and follow your energy and desires. "What do I want now?" While energy is low, set yourself small and very simple goals. Go to the shop. Finish the book. Organize your closet.
